Diff Report
Run #517d51ae434de: XHProf Run (Namespace=drupal-perf-cottser)
vs.
Run #517d52b5a5611: XHProf Run (Namespace=drupal-perf-cottser)
Tip
Click a function name below to drill down.

Regression/Improvement summary for Drupal\Core\Cache\DatabaseBackend::get

Drupal\Core\Cache\DatabaseBackend::getRun #517d51ae434deRun #517d52b5a5611DiffDiff%
Number of Function Calls56 56 0 0.0%
Incl. Wall Time (microsec)44,547 44,738 191 0.4%
Incl. Wall Time (microsec) per call 795 799 3 0.4%
Excl. Wall Time (microsec)346 347 1 0.3%
Incl. CPU (microsecs)30,120 29,551 -569 -1.9%
Incl. CPU (microsecs) per call 538 528 -10 -1.9%
Excl. CPU (microsec)335 289 -46 -13.7%
Incl. MemUse (bytes)1,764,088 1,762,800 -1,288 -0.1%
Incl. MemUse (bytes) per call 31,502 31,479 -23 -0.1%
Excl. MemUse (bytes)4,392 4,392 0 0.0%
Incl. PeakMemUse (bytes)2,302,160 2,304,144 1,984 0.1%
Incl. PeakMemUse (bytes) per call 41,110 41,145 35 0.1%
Excl. PeakMemUse (bytes)4,088 4,264 176 4.3%

Parent/Child Regression/Improvement report for Drupal\Core\Cache\DatabaseBackend::get [View Callgraph Diff]


Function NameCalls DiffCalls
Diff%
Incl. Wall
Diff
(microsec)
IWall
Diff%
Incl. CPU Diff
(microsec)
ICpu
Diff%
Incl.
MemUse
Diff
(bytes)
IMemUse
Diff%
Incl.
PeakMemUse
Diff
(bytes)
IPeakMemUse
Diff%
Current Function
Drupal\Core\Cache\DatabaseBackend::get0 N/A% 191 7.9% -569 -40.8% -1,288 -12.6% 1,984 19.4%
Exclusive Metrics Diff for Current Function1 0.5% -46 -8.1% 0 0.0% 176 8.9%
Parent functions
Drupal\Core\Config\CachedStorage::read0 N/A% 803 420.4% -100 -17.6% -48 -3.7% 72 3.6%
menu_tree_page_data0 N/A% -208 -108.9% -135 -23.7% -64 -5.0% 136 6.9%
Drupal\Core\Plugin\Discovery\CacheDecorator::getCachedDefinitions0 N/A% -204 -106.8% -164 -28.8% -16 -1.2% 216 10.9%
_node_types_build0 N/A% -190 -99.5% -134 -23.6% 0 0.0% 0 0.0%
entity_get_view_modes0 N/A% -87 -45.5% -51 -9.0% 0 0.0% 0 0.0%
_menu_build_tree0 N/A% -31 -16.2% 4 0.7% 40 3.1% -200 -10.1%
Drupal\Core\Utility\ThemeRegistry::__construct0 N/A% 24 12.6% -53 -9.3% -1,456 -113.0% 1,560 78.6%
Drupal\Core\Extension\CachedModuleHandler::getBootstrapModules0 N/A% 22 11.5% 7 1.2% 0 0.0% 0 0.0%
_field_info_collate_types0 N/A% 22 11.5% 58 10.2% -32 -2.5% -32 -1.6%
Drupal\field\FieldInfo::getInstances0 N/A% 19 9.9% 71 12.5% 24 1.9% 24 1.2%
system_list0 N/A% 18 9.4% -19 -3.3% 0 0.0% 0 0.0%
Drupal\Core\Utility\CacheArray::__construct0 N/A% 16 8.4% -17 -3.0% 0 0.0% 0 0.0%
Drupal\field\FieldInfo::getBundleExtraFields0 N/A% -13 -6.8% -20 -3.5% 0 0.0% 0 0.0%
Drupal\Core\Extension\CachedModuleHandler::getHookInfo0 N/A% 4 2.1% -2 -0.4% 0 0.0% 0 0.0%
variable_initialize0 N/A% -4 -2.1% -1 -0.2% 0 0.0% 0 0.0%
Drupal\Core\Extension\CachedModuleHandler::getCachedImplementationInfo0 N/A% 0 0.0% -13 -2.3% 264 20.5% 208 10.5%
Child functions
Drupal\Core\Cache\DatabaseBackend::getMultiple0 N/A% 203 106.3% -525 -92.3% -1,288 -100.0% 1,808 91.1%
reset0 N/A% -13 -6.8% 2 0.4% 0 0.0% 0 0.0%